Importance of Powder-Free for Medical Applications
Powder-free nitrile gloves are crucial in medical environments. The absence of powder reduces the risk of allergic reactions among patients and healthcare workers, especially for individuals with sensitive skin or latex allergies.
Additionally, powder can interfere with certain medical procedures. For example, surgical sites demand an uncontaminated area to ensure patient safety. Any residue from powdered gloves could compromise sterility. Furthermore, these gloves provide better tactile sensitivity. Healthcare professionals rely on their sense of touch when performing delicate tasks like suturing or administering injections. With a smooth surface, powder-free nitrile gloves enhance dexterity without sacrificing protection.
In infection control protocols, every detail matters. Powder-free options help maintain hygiene standards while delivering reliable barrier protection against pathogens and contaminants in clinical settings. Using such gloves demonstrates a commitment to both safety and quality care.

Tips for Proper Glove Usage and Disposal
There are several key practices to remember regarding proper glove usage and disposal.
Choosing the Right Gloves for the Job
Different tasks require different types of gloves, so it’s important to select the appropriate glove material and size for each task.
Properly Donning and Removing Gloves
Putting on and taking off gloves correctly is crucial for preventing contamination. Avoid touching the outside of the glove with your bare hands.
Regularly Changing Gloves
Reusing gloves can lead to cross-contamination, so changing them frequently is important, especially when moving between tasks or handling different materials.
Disposing of Gloves Safely
Used gloves should be disposed of in a designated waste bin, as they may contain harmful substances or germs. Never leave used gloves lying around or attempt to wash and reuse them.
Proper Hand Hygiene
Wearing gloves does not replace proper hand-washing practices. Always wash your hands before and after using gloves and any time they become visibly soiled. This helps prevent the spread of germs and maintains the effectiveness of gloves during use.
Environmental Considerations: The Impact of Nitrile Gloves
Nitrile gloves have become a staple in medical settings. However, their production and disposal raise environmental concerns. Nitrile is made from synthetic rubber, which is more durable than latex but has an ecological footprint.
The manufacturing process involves petroleum-based chemicals, which contribute to pollution. Additionally, the sheer volume of disposable gloves used daily adds to landfill waste. While nitrile gloves offer safety and protection for healthcare professionals, their long-term environmental impact must be noticed. Some manufacturers are exploring eco-friendly alternatives or practices that reduce waste during production. Biodegradable materials are being researched as potential substitutes for traditional nitrile compounds.
Healthcare facilities also play a significant role in mitigating these effects by implementing recycling programs where possible. Awareness surrounding glove usage can lead to better choices that balance health needs with environmental responsibility.

Best Practices for Using Nitrile Gloves Disposable in Medical Settings
Using Nitrile Gloves Disposable in medical settings requires attention to detail to ensure safety and effectiveness. Always inspect each pair before use. Look for tears, holes, or any defects that could compromise protection. When wearing gloves, ensure your hands are dry and clean. This practice prevents contamination and provides a snug fit.
During procedures, avoid touching surfaces unnecessarily. This reduces the risk of spreading pathogens from one surface to another. If you accidentally touch a non-sterile area, change your gloves immediately. After completing tasks, remove gloves carefully to prevent skin exposure to contaminants. Use proper disposal methods by placing them in designated biohazard waste bins.
Hands should always be washed thoroughly after glove removal. This is crucial for maintaining hygiene standards within clinical environments, where infections can easily spread through improper practices.

1. What are nitrile powder-free gloves made of?
Nitrile gloves are made from synthetic rubber, which provides excellent resistance against chemicals and punctures while being latex-free.
2. Are Nitrile Gloves Disposable safe for people with latex allergies?
Nitrile Gloves Disposable are an excellent alternative for individuals with latex allergies, as they do not contain any natural rubber proteins.
3. How should I store nitrile gloves?
Store them in a cool and dry place away from direct sunlight or heat sources to maintain their quality.
4. Can I reuse nitrile powder-free gloves?
These gloves are designed for single-use only to ensure maximum hygiene and safety; reusing them can lead to contamination risks.
